Hop on board the East Coast Pipeline Express with me here at Robbiefarr.com and travel with us through a journey over the next six months that will take you throughout most states in Australia where we will show case the East Coast Pipeline Racing Team.

This season I will be piloting the Q7 J&J Sprintcar for the East Coast Pipeline Team at over fifty events right throughout the country. This is a completely new team right from the ground up, probably the only part of the team that I can say is not new would be my crew chief Nick Speed, Nick has work tirelessly in the off season to make what most drivers dream about a reality for me and the team principal Barry Waldron. Everything was new for this season, sprintcars, engines, pit mule, all the gear that is need for a successful team plus more and also probably one of the most luxurious sprintcar trailers seen in this country to make sure the team work in a clean and very happy environment during the season.
